Abstract
Systems and methods for automatically identifying end credits in a media item are disclosed. An analysis component analyzes a media item and identifies a transition point in the media item where end credits begin and a presentation component presents a prompt, such as a survey, based on the transition point. In another aspect, a monitoring component monitors at least one of content or audio of the media item. According to this aspect, the analysis component analyzes the at least one of the content or the audio, identifies a pattern of the media item associated with the end credits, and identifies the transition point as a function of the pattern. In various aspects, the pattern is associated with a streaming of text, a music soundtrack, an absence of speech, an absence object movement, or an absence of an appearance of objects included in the body of the media item.
